Properties
Description
Xylan-PEG-poly aspartic acid forms a three-element assembly designed to amalgamate xylan's renewable polymeric architecture—comprising β-1,4-xylose chains extracted from hemicellulose biomass—with poly aspartic acid's biochemical profile through polyethylene glycol conjugation. The hydrophilic biopolymer backbone ensures moisture retention capacity and mucous membrane adherence while optimizing biological system harmonization.

Glycan Structure
Its glycan structure is a linear backbone of β-1,4-linked D-xylose residues with side-chain substitutions including α-linked arabinofuranose, glucuronic acid/4-O-methyl-glucuronic acid, and acetyl groups at O-2 or O-3 positions.
